Title: Materials Data on U6Mn by Materials Project

Abstract

U6Mn crystallizes in the tetragonal I4/mcm space group. The structure is three-dimensional. there are two inequivalent U sites. In the first U site, U is bonded in a 4-coordinate geometry to two U and two equivalent Mn atoms. There are one shorter (2.62 Å) and one longer (2.72 Å) U–U bond lengths. Both U–Mn bond lengths are 2.77 Å. In the second U site, U is bonded in a distorted T-shaped geometry to three U atoms. The U–U bond length is 2.68 Å. Mn is bonded in a 10-coordinate geometry to eight equivalent U and two equivalent Mn atoms. Both Mn–Mn bond lengths are 2.65 Å.
